What Makes Indonesian VCO Unique?
Virgin Coconut Oil (VCO) from Indonesia stands out for several reasons. The first is freshness. Local producers often process coconuts within hours of harvest to preserve their natural nutrients. This quick turnaround ensures the oil retains its high lauric acid content—a fatty acid known for antimicrobial and immune-boosting properties.
Another factor is traditional craftsmanship. Many Indonesian VCO producers still use cold-press and fermentation techniques passed down through generations. These natural methods create a clean, rich, and aromatic oil that appeals to global buyers looking for authenticity.
Lastly, traceability and sustainability are key strengths. Ethical sourcing and environmentally friendly practices have become central to Indonesia’s VCO production. How Indonesia’s Virgin Coconut Oil Is Made
The production process of virgin coconut oil in Indonesia is a blend of traditional wisdom and modern technology. It starts with the selection of mature, fresh coconuts harvested at their nutritional peak. After peeling and grating the white coconut meat, producers extract coconut milk, which is then processed using one of several methods—cold-pressing, fermentation, or centrifugation.
- Cold-Press Method: This technique involves pressing the grated coconut meat mechanically without heat. The oil separates naturally from the water and solids, producing a pure, unrefined product with a mild coconut aroma. Cold-pressed VCO is the most sought-after type for cosmetics and dietary supplements.
- Fermentation Method: In this method, the coconut milk is allowed to ferment naturally for several hours. The oil gradually rises to the top and is then filtered. This process is slower but yields oil rich in antioxidants and nutrients.
- Centrifuge Extraction: Larger coconut oil companies often use high-speed centrifuges to separate the oil from coconut milk efficiently. It’s a modern approach that maintains the oil’s natural purity while allowing higher production volumes.
Regardless of the method, the focus remains the same: preserving quality, purity, and the oil’s natural properties.

Applications of VCO Across Industries
Virgin Coconut Oil from Indonesia isn’t just popular in the kitchen. Its versatility makes it valuable across multiple industries.
- Food and Beverage Industry: VCO’s natural flavor, stability, and health benefits make it an ideal choice for cooking oils, salad dressings, smoothies, and functional food ingredients. Health-conscious brands often market it as a superfood rich in Medium-Chain Triglycerides (MCTs).
- Cosmetics and Skincare: In cosmetics, VCO acts as a natural moisturizer, makeup remover, and hair conditioner. It’s rich in antioxidants and easily absorbed by the skin, making it a favorite ingredient for beauty brands.
- Pharmaceuticals and Supplements: Pharmaceutical manufacturers use VCO for its ant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ties. It’s also a common ingredient in dietary supplements targeting immunity and metabolism.
These diverse applications continue to expand VCO’s global market, positioning Indonesia as the go-to source for high-quality supply.
